Salt Composition

Cetirizine (2.5mg/5ml) + Ambroxol (30mg/5ml)

Overview AX Cold Syrup

Coughs can be effectively managed with the multi-ingredient formulation, AX Cold Syrup. This medication targets allergy symptoms including nasal discharge, sneezing, itchy eyes, swelling, congestion, and ocular watering. It also works to thin phlegm, facilitating easier expulsion. AX Cold Syrup should be administered as directed by your physician, with or without food. Dosage is tailored to individual needs and response. Complete the prescribed course of treatment; premature cessation may lead to symptom recurrence and potential worsening of your condition. Inform your doctor of all other medications you are using, as interactions are possible. Common, usually transient, side effects include nausea, dry mouth, tiredness, drowsiness, and allergic responses. Report any concerning side effects to your doctor immediately. Drowsiness and dizziness are possible; avoid driving or activities demanding concentration until the effects are known.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to the potential for increased dizziness. Self-medication and recommending this medicine to others is strongly discouraged. Adequate hydration is recommended during treatment. Prior to use, disclose any kidney or liver conditions to your physician. Pregnant or lactating individuals should seek medical advice before taking this syrup.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Consuming AX Cold Syrup with alcohol can lead to significant sleepiness.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of AX Cold Syrup during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to a f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any possible risks prior to prescribing this medication. Seek medical advice before use.

Breast feedingBreast feedingUNSAFE

Nursing mothers should avoid AX Cold Syrup. Evidence indicates potential infant harm from this medication.

DrivingDriving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The effect of AX Cold Syrup on driving ability is undetermined. Refrain from operating a vehicle if you experience symptoms impairing concentration or reaction time.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with kidney impairment should use AX Cold Syrup c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consult a physician before use. It's contraindicated in those with severe kidney disease and might induce excessive drowsiness in individuals with end-stage renal disease.

LiverLi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

AX Cold Syrup is likely safe for individuals with hepatic impairment. Existing evidence indicates dose modification of AX Cold Syrup may be unnecessary in such cases. Physician consultation is recommended.

What if you forget to take AX Cold Syrup :

Should you forget a dose of AX Cold Syrup,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on AX Cold Syrup

Don't consume alcohol while using AX Cold Syrup. Alcohol will worsen the drowsiness it causes.
Breastfeeding while taking AX Cold Syrup, which contains the antihistamine cetirizine, is not recommended. Cetirizine can transfer to breast milk and potentially harm your baby. If prescribed AX Cold Syrup, tell your doctor you are breastfeeding.
AX Cold Syrup may cause drowsiness. Avoid driving, operating machinery, working at heights, or engaging in hazardous activities until you know how it affects you. Report any drowsiness to your doctor.
Increasing your dosage beyond the recommended amount won't necessarily improve results; it could significantly increase your risk of side effects and toxicity. If your symptoms persist or worsen despite taking the recommended dose, consult your doctor.
Yes, AX Cold Syrup may cause dry mouth. To alleviate this, drink water frequently throughout the day and keep a glass by your bedside overnight.
